When I try to suspend the system, it suspends (acpiconf -s 3), but when
I try to resume it panics:
ioapic_suspend: not implemented!

panic: pmap_invalidate_page: interrupts disabled
cpuid = 0
KDB: enter: panic
Is it known problem? How do I make resume work with acpi?
I'm willing to test any patches.
